Chelsea great Gianfranco Zola has insisted at Antonio Conte is the right man to lead the current team beyond the end of this season, the BBC reports via The Metro.
Conte has endured a difficult season as the Blues head coach with reports continuing to suggest he’s on his way out of Stamford Bridge.
After a fantastic first campaign for the Italian in winning the Premier League and reaching the FA Cup final, things have gone pear-shaped this time round for the 48-year-old.
When speaking to the BBC, Zola believes that despite the issues around the team, Conte is the best man to turn our fortunes around.
The Metro quotes Zola saying:
“I genuinely think he is a good fit for Chelsea, one of the best coaches around, and as I want the best for Chelsea so hope his stays.
“There are a few issues, but hopefully they solve them.”
Despite still being a fan favourite with the Chelsea faithful, it may be of best interest for the club to part ways with Conte, even if it means a successful end to the season.
However, the memories Conte has shared with the club will never be forgotten by fans.
